Explore how prophecy guides the view of history from ancient ruins to modern travels.
This book surveys the scope and power of Scripture prophecy, showing how predictions span nations, cities, and key moments in world history. It emphasizes that the grand theme is the coming Messiah and how prophecy unfolds across both old and new eras. Rich with historical context and travel narratives, it connects biblical expectations with real places and events.
